de cassistont principo WALTER WOHLHETER Assistant Principal San jose, California is Mr. VVohlheter's birth place. He was President of the Senior Class at the University of Redlands, Where he majored in history. He also at- tended VVhittier, USC, Stanford, and UCLA colleges, majoring in education. In 1946 he started teaching at MHS. He became Vice Principal in 1952 and in 1956, Assistant Principal, He enjoys the wonderful students and faculty he has to work with at Montebello Senior High Schoolf, CINS VIVIAN LEMON Dean of Girls Missouri is Miss Lemonfs home state. She graduated cum laude from the University of Idaho, and also attend- ed Mills College, USC, and Whittier College. She ma- jored in history, and her principal activities were drama, speech contests, annual staff, and student government. She has been at Montebello for twenty-two years. Be- fore becoming Dean of Girls in 1944, she taught history. Miss Lemon admires the intense loyalty and pride which our students develop toward their schoolf, EARL ODY Dean of Boys Mr. Ody was born in Akron, Ohio. Majoring in math, he attended the University of Akron, Wfhittier College, and LA State. He served in the US Air Force for four years as a P38 pilot. He has been at Montebello for ten years. Before be- coming Dean of Boys, he taught shop physics and plane geometry, coached C and D basketball, and IV football, and was also director of student activities. In his deal- ings With Ml-IS, Mr. Ody finds that his biggest help is the enthusiastic spirit of the student bodyf'

Dr. Wlhinnery, before becoming superin- tendent of schools in 1949, had served as Principal of MHS and Director of Adult Education. He received his BA from UCLA, his MA from Occidental College, and his EdD from USC. He has just completed a two year term as International President of Phi Delta Kappa, which is a honorary fraternity for men in education. tQ,kf qyxi ix mg 'Tf ,A , vw., DR. jOHN C.
